Understanding Type 8300: What Is actually It?
What Is Form 8300?
Form 8300 is actually a documentation needed by the Irs (IRS) that mentions cash deals exceeding $10,000. Its own main reason is to deal with money laundering as well as other financial crimes. If your service receives such remittances in a solitary purchase or even associated transactions, you are actually legitimately obligated to file this form.
Why Is Form 8300 Important?
The value of Form 8300 may not be actually overstated. Through requiring organizations to state huge cash money deals, it aids sustain clarity in monetary transactions as well as stops illegal tasks. Failure to submit this kind can lead to substantial greats or maybe illegal charges.
Who Needs to File Form 8300?
Any organization company or even individual that acquires over $10,000 in money must file Type 8300. This includes:
-   Retailers Service providers Real estate agents Car dealerships Casinos 
 
If you come under any one of these groups and take care of big cash money repayments, this type is actually essential.
Key Terms Related to Type 8300
Cash Interpretation in IRS Terms
For internal revenue service stating purposes, "cash money" isn't simply buck costs; it consists of:
 
-   Coins Currency Traveler's checks Money orders 
 
Understanding what trains as cash money is going to help guarantee that you're accurately mentioning transactions.
What Constitutes Relevant Transactions?
Related transactions develop when several cash money repayments are actually created by a single person in near time proximity-- commonly within a singular organization time or even full week-- totting much more than $10,000. Realizing these nuances can spare you from pricey mistakes.
